как уменьшить файл гибернации windows 10
Как в Windows уменьшить размер файла гибернации
С уществует, как минимум пять разных способов увеличить объем системного раздела. Так, вы можете удалить временные файлы, выполнить сжатие данных на диске, расширить объем системного диска за счет пользовательского раздела, очистить некоторые системные каталоги, например папку WinSxS. Также увеличить объем диска с установленной на нем операционной системой можно, удалив или оптимизировав файл гибернации hiberfil.sys.
Если на вашем компьютере активирован спящий режим, в корне системного раздела операционная система создает скрытый файл hiberfil.sys. Когда вы переводите своего железного друга в спящий режим, в него записывается содержимое RAM. При выходе из спящего режима данные извлекаются и передаются обратно в оперативную память. Таким образом, размер файл гибернации напрямую зависит от объема оперативки.
Некоторые пользователи с целью получения дополнительного места на диске удаляют файл hiberfil.sys. Однако такой способ может оказаться не всегда приемлемым. Особенно это касается Windows 8 и 8.1. Дело в том, что начиная с восьмой версии, в Windows используется новый, более быстрый запуск системы. При выключении компьютера под управлением Windows 8 или 8.1 система замораживает сессию ядра, сохраняя данные в файле hiberfil.sys. То есть если вы его удалите, то ваша восьмерка больше не сможет быстро загружаться.
В Windows 7 всё немножко проще. Если вы не собираетесь использовать спящий режим, файл гибернации можно безболезненно удалить. Для чего сначала нужно перейти в раздел управления электропитанием, найти там опцию «Настройка перехода в спящий режим» и в качестве значения параметра «Переводить компьютер в спящий режим» установить «Никогда».
Затем запускаем консоль CMD (от имени администратора) и выполняем следующую команду:
Как уменьшить файл гибернации в Windows 10
Файл гибернации занимает чрезмерно много места на системном диске С? Его можно уменьшить без отключения самого спящего режима, и, следовательно, функции быстрой загрузки Windows 10. Узнаем подробнее, за что он отвечает и как уменьшить его размер.
Сколько места на диске занимает файл гибернации
Он может занимать слишком много места на системном диске, так как его размер зависит от объема оперативной памяти. По умолчанию он «весит» 40% от объема оперативной памяти. Например, при 16 Гб ОЗУ размер составляет 6,8 Гб.
В сети можно найти немало информации о том, как его полностью отключить с помощью простой команды. В какой-то мере это выход, но когда используете Windows 8.1 или 10 – это не всегда хорошее решение. Потому что, вопреки своему названию, файл отвечает не только за переключение системы в спящий режим.
Как проверить размер файла?
Поскольку файл скрытый, то не отображается в окне Проводника. Но, если нужно узнать его объем, то можно его отобразить в корневом каталоге.
Откройте окно Проводника, выберите Файлы– Изменить параметры папок и поиска.
Перейдите на вкладку «Вид», в дополнительных параметрах найдите пункт «Скрывать защищенные системные файлы» и снимите с него галку. Затем найдите пункт «Показывать скрытые файлы, и папки» и установите флажок.
После этого появится в Проводнике. Он носит название hiberfil.sys и находится в корневом каталоге диска С или другом, на котором установлена операционная система. Теперь можно посмотреть его текущий размер.
За что отвечает файл гибернации в Windows 10?
Многим кажется, что файл используется исключительно функцией гибернации. Но это не так, еще он нужен двух дополнительным функциям – гибридного сна и быстрого запуска системы.
Гибернация по своему действию подобна спящему режиму, то есть переводит систему в состояние ожидания до ее пробуждения, но работает немного по-другому.
Тогда как, спящий режим записывает текущее состояние в оперативную память и переходит в состояние пониженного потребления энергии (отсутствие питания приводит к отключению ждущего режима и выключению компьютера), гибернация сохраняет состояние системы (запущенные программы, открытые документы, положение окон на рабочем столе) на жесткий диск в hiberfil.sys и только потом выключает компьютер. После перезагрузки вернет систему к тому месту, где была прекращена работа.
Второй функцией, которая использует hiberfil.sys, является гибридный спящий режим – это сочетание гибернации и сна. Windows использует файл для сохранения текущего состояния, когда переходит в состояние обычного сна. При пробуждении Windows начинает стандартное считывание состояния компьютера из оперативной памяти. Но, если во время сна отключится электропитание и спящий режим прервется (обнулится оперативная память), то не потеряем текущее состояние системы – при включении компьютера все будет загружено из hiberfil.sys, который представляет своего рода «backup».
Быстрый запуск – последняя функция, которая использует hiberfil.sys, и об этот мало кто знает. По умолчанию функция активирована в Windows 8.1, 10 и отвечает за ускоренный запуск системы, особенно когда на компьютере или ноутбуке установлен SSD. Как она работает? Windows при выключении сохраняет основную информацию (образ ядра, загруженные драйвера и т.д.) в hiberfil.sys, а при включении компьютера считывает без необходимости их повторной инициализации. Поэтому система запускается быстрее, так как грузит намного меньшее количество новых данных при последующем запуске. Это невероятно полезная функция, которая значительно ускоряет запуск Windows.
Как уменьшить размер файла гибернации в Windows 10?
Одним из способов является полное отключение гибернации, но тогда потеряем перечисленные преимущества. Если для большинства пользователей сама гибернация и гибридный спящий режим не важны, то отсутствие быстрого запуска ощущается, даже когда установлен SSD.
Есть способ значительно уменьшить объем hiberfil.sys и оставить функцию быстрого запуска активной. Гибернация может работать в двух режимах – полном и ограниченном.
При полной функциональности размер hiberfil.sys составляет 40% от установленной оперативной памяти и поддерживает все три перечисленные функции – гибернацию, гибридное состояние сна и быстрый запуск. В ограниченном режиме hiberfil.sys имеет вдвое меньший размер, 20% от объема оперативной памяти, и поддерживает только быстрый запуск.
Как включить ограниченный режим?
Нажмите сочетание клавиш Windows +X для вызова меню в левом нижнем углу экрана. В списке доступных вариантов выберите «Командная строка (Администратор)».
В экране командной строки введите команду, которая переключит гибернацию в ограниченный режим, то есть освободится несколько гигабайт свободного места на диске С:
powercfg /h /type reduced
Подтвердите команду нажатием клавиши Enter. Отобразится подтверждение внести изменения вместе с данными о текущем его размере.
Самое главное, что выполнение этой операции не затрагивает ускоренный запуск, так что Windows 10 по-прежнему будет запускаться быстро. Файл останется на диске, только в гораздо меньшем объеме, достаточным для поддержки функции ускоренного включения компьютера.
Если в дальнейшем хотите вернуться к исходному размеру, то нужно ввести команду:
powercfg /h /type full
Что делать, если команда не работает?
Может произойти так, что при вводе команды для перехода в ограниченный режим возникает ошибка о неправильном параметре. Это можно исправить.
Введите в Командной строке команду, которая его полностью обнулит:
Подтверждаем выполнение на Enter. После перезапустите компьютер и введите команду повторно:
powercfg /h /type reduced
На этот раз команда должна быть обработана без ошибок.
Как изменить размер файла hiberfil.sys в Windows 10
Обновление: Перестаньте получать сообщения об ошибках и замедляйте работу своей системы с помощью нашего инструмента оптимизации. Получите это сейчас на эту ссылку
Большинство пользователей Windows используют функцию гибернации для быстрого запуска Windows и возобновления работы. Однако гибернация включена по умолчанию на большинстве ПК с Windows 10 и не отображается по умолчанию в меню питания или на переключателе питания. В Windows 10 эту функцию можно добавить к кнопке «Питание» в меню «Пуск». См. Наши инструкции по включению гибернации в Windows 10.
В режиме гибернации используется файл hiberfil.sys для записи текущего состояния всех открытых приложений, файлов и драйверы, и когда компьютер будет перезагружен, вы вернетесь с того места, на котором остановились. По умолчанию размер hiberfil.sys составляет около 40% физической памяти системы. Если вы хотите отключить спящий режим без отключения быстрого запуска, вы можете уменьшить размер файла гибернации (hiberfil.sys) примерно до 20% вашей оперативной памяти в Windows 10.
Как уменьшить размер файла hiberfil.sys в режиме ожидания
Это значение можно изменить на любое другое значение от 50 до 100%, но если Windows требуется больше, чем установлено вами, компьютер не перейдет в режим гибернации.
Следующие шаги показывают, как изменить размер файла hiberfil.sys.
Уменьшите файл Hiberfil.sys в свойствах
Найдите файл hiberfil.sys на диске C и следуйте инструкциям по сжатию файла и увеличению дискового пространства.
Ноябрьское обновление 2021:
Вы также можете отключить спящий режим, чтобы уменьшить нагрузку на систему.
Отключите режим гибернации, чтобы увеличить место на жестком диске в Windows
Что произойдет, если вы без разбора уменьшите размер файла hiberfil.sys?
Если размер файла гибернации слишком мал, Windows может выдать ошибку завершения работы.
Если Windows не завершает работу из-за слишком малого размера файла гибернации, может появиться синий экран со следующим кодом ошибки и сообщением о завершении работы:
ОСТАНОВИТЬ 0x000000A0 INTERNER_PROWER_ERROR
Параметр 1
Параметр 2
Параметр 3
Параметр 4
В настройках представлена следующая информация:
Параметр 1 всегда равен 0x0000000B.
Параметр 2 равен размеру неактивного файла состояния в байтах.
Параметр 3 равен количеству байтов данных, оставшихся для сжатия и записи в файл гибернации.
Параметр 4 для этой ошибки не используется.
CCNA, веб-разработчик, ПК для устранения неполадок
Я компьютерный энтузиаст и практикующий ИТ-специалист. У меня за плечами многолетний опыт работы в области компьютерного программирования, устранения неисправностей и ремонта оборудования. Я специализируюсь на веб-разработке и дизайне баз данных. У меня также есть сертификат CCNA для проектирования сетей и устранения неполадок.
Как удалить hiberfil.sys в windows 10
Основной причиной удаления Hiberfil.sys с системного диска Windows 10 — является освобождение свободного пространства. Ведь зачастую размер этого файла достигает 2-5 ГБ и больше. Для начала разберемся, что он из себя представляет, и можно ли его в принципе удалять?
Что такое Hiberfil.sys и откуда он взялся в Windows 10?
Hiberfil.sys — системный файл, который создаётся, а заем постоянно перезаписывается в момент перевод компьютера в спящий режим. Казалось бы, как связаны два этих факта? Дело в том, что когда пользователь переключает ПК в “сон”, то все данные из оперативки переносится на жёсткий диск.
Именно поэтому компьютер быстро включается после спящего режима. Его вес примерно сопоставим с размером ОЗУ. А если быть более точным, то равен тому объёму, которым был занята оперативная память в момент выключения ПК.
Как найти hiberfil.sys?
Сохраняем изменения и открываем проводник в корневом каталоге С. Находим там необходимый файл hiberfil.sys. К сожалению, удалить его вручную — не получится, так как он системный. Но существует другие способы сделать это.
Как полностью удалить файл hiberfile?
Hiberfil.sys не нужно удалять, нужно идти к “корню” проблемы. Другими словами: отключить гибернацию, тогда этот файл удалиться самостоятельно.
Через настройки панели управления Windows 10
Готово! Перезагружать Windows 10 не стоит, все изменения, связанные с hiberfile уже сохранены.
Отключить гибернацию с помощью командной строки (PowerShell)
Выполняя данную инструкцию, вы можете один из перечисленных в заголовке инструментов. Мы рассмотрим оба способа для Windows 10…
Как изменить размер hiberfil.sys в Windows 10
В этом посте мы покажем вам, как увеличить или уменьшить размер hiberfil.sys файл в Windows 10 с помощью командной строки powercfg. Файл Hiberfil.sys — это системный файл, который используется Windows для поддержки гибернации.
Windows поддерживает гибернацию, копируя содержимое памяти на диск. Система сжимает содержимое памяти перед сохранением его на диске, что уменьшает необходимое дисковое пространство до уровня, меньшего, чем общий объем физической памяти в системе.
Если вы обнаружите, что файл hiber.sys становится слишком большим и занимает дисковое пространство, вы можете рассмотреть возможность его уменьшения. Теперь в Windows 10 размер файла hiber.sys по умолчанию составляет 40% от размера вашей оперативной памяти. Вы не можете уменьшить его дальше. Вы можете отключить спящий режим или изменить его размер от 40% до 100% от размера вашей оперативной памяти.
Чтобы узнать необходимый синтаксис, в CMD с повышенными правами введите следующее и нажмите Enter:
Измените размер hiberfil.sys в Windows 10
Чтобы увеличить или уменьшить размер файла Hibernate (hiberfil.sys) в Windows 10, выполните следующие действия:
Давайте посмотрим на процедуру подробно.
В меню WinX откройте командную строку от имени администратора.
Чтобы настроить размер файла гибернации на 100 процентов, используйте следующую команду:
Чтобы настроить размер файла гибернации на 50 процентов, используйте следующую команду:
Windows 10 не позволяет уменьшить размер файла hiberfil.sys, если размер файла составляет 40% или меньше размера установленной оперативной памяти.
Что произойдет, если вы без разбора уменьшите размер файла hiberfil.sys?
Если размер файла Hibernate слишком мал, Windows может выдать ошибку Stop.
Если Windows не может перейти в спящий режим из-за слишком маленького размера файла гибернации, может появиться синий экран со следующим кодом и сообщением об ошибке Stop:
ОСТАНОВИТЬ 0x000000A0 ВНУТРЕННЯЯ ПИТАНИЕ_ОШИБКА
Параметр 1
Параметр 2
Параметр 3
Параметр 4
Параметры предоставляют следующую информацию: